Abstract
The BIMEVOX materials can be prepared in four polymorphic modifications: α,β,γ,γ′, depending on Bi: V ratio and the nature/concentration of dopant. Polymorphic transitions take place on heat/cool cycles and can be detected by DTA and by variations in conductivity Arrhenius plots.
